1970 Junior TT

Sporting the Gordon Blair-designed long megaphone exhaust, former MGP winner Tom Dickie (Gus Kuhn Seeley) exits Parliament Square

In this print from BikeSport TT Race Pics, we are transported back to the thrilling atmosphere of the 1970 Junior TT race. Former Manx Grand Prix winner Tom Dickie, astride his powerful Gus Kuhn Seeley motorcycle, takes center stage as he exits Parliament Square with sheer determination etched on his face. What makes this image truly remarkable is the striking design detail that catches our eye - the Gordon Blair-designed long megaphone exhaust adorning Dickie's machine. This unique feature not only adds a touch of vintage charm but also hints at the raw power and speed that these riders possessed during those exhilarating races.
